Entrepreneur Development Center Southwest Tennessee

Fiscal year ending 2021. Filed on November 3, 2021.

541 Wiley Parker Rd
Jackson, Tennessee 38305

Entrepreneur Development Center Southwest Tennessee (EIN: 45-5186181), also known as Theco, has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2024. In its fiscal year 2021 IRS Form 990 filing, Entrepreneur Development Center Southwest Tennessee,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 out of 22 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$57,426. The highest compensated employee at Entrepreneur Development Center Southwest Tennessee is Ben Harris with fiscal year 2021 compensation of $103,247.

Mission Statement

THE ENTREPRENEUR DEVELOPMENT CENTER ASSISTS ASPIRING SMALL BUSINESS OWNERS IN BY PROVIDING EDUCATION, MENTORING, TRAINING AND KNOWLEDGE TO ASSIST THEM IN THEIR QUEST TO BECOME ENTREPRENEURS. ENTREPRENEURSHIP CAN DO MORE THAN JUST CREATE JOBS; IT CAN CREATE NEW WAYS TO ADDRESS THE CHALLENGES THAT RESIDE IN OUR COMMUNITY. OUR MISSION IS TO CONNECT ENTREPRENEURS WITH THE CRITICAL RESOURCES THEY NEED TO CREATE, BUILD AND GROW THEIR BUSINESSES. THESE CRITICAL RESOURCES ARE EXPERIENCED MENTORS, CAPITAL, TRAINING, KNOWLEDGE AND A SUPPORTIVE COMMUNITY. RELATED PROGRAMS TO THIS MISSION INCLUDE A CODING ACADEMY FOR HIGH SCHOOL STUDENTS; FUNDING FOR MEDICAL DEVICE RESEARCH ACTIVITIES FOR LOCAL PHYSCIANS; AND A LOCAL LIFE STYLE MAGAZINE FOCUSED TOWARD COMMUNITY OPPORTUNITIES AND BUSINESS.
